    Good Points: Look fantastic.
    Excellent soundstage.


    Bad Points: Needs a lot of power (at least 100 - 125 watts).
    Can sound bass heavy / muffled. Particularly in distorted guitar sections. In music like Iron Maiden and Metallica, all you hear is the bassist, the guitars are just messy.
    Need a particularly large room.


    General comments: If you don't listen to overdriven guitars, then these Cyrus Icon X4 speakers sound excellent. The soundstage is huge and they can certainly produce all the volume you'll ever need at all the frequencies (8 inch subs take care of the bass!). I found them to be too bottom heavy with not enough sparkle in the treble (have since moved to Monitor Audio Gold 60).

    These speakers take AGES to run in. It was a couple of months before they sounded right. When I first got them I was very disappointed, I knew they would take a while to run in, but thought that the sound I had after a week was all I would get. Fortunately they improved, but it took a long time.

    I owned these speakers for a couple of years and would not recommend them as they aren't versatile enough.

    Need a pretty large room as they realistically need to be at least a metre from the wall. They are pretty tall too which could look overbaring in a small room. On the plus side they are very elegant.
